Other fitness related sites on the net
There are many thousands of fitness related web sites on the internet. Some have a general approach
covering a whole range of fitness related media and others are more specific. There are sites on body building,
stretching, strength training, yoga, pilates, speed development, vertical jump development and many more.
The range of fitness, sports and exercise related information is unlimited. There are even fitness forums and
blogs where anyone and everyone can share training methods and exercise advice with suggestions for fat
loss, weight gain, performance training, and injury rehabilitation to name a few.
Out of these sites some have fitness products to sell and write their articles with bias towards these products
and promises of rippling abdominal muscles in 6 days! They contain images of fitness models, who in all
honesty have probably never used said contraptions! Some sites sell fitness training methods under the illusion
that they are the latest top secret fitness method straight from the underground! There are also the sites who
conform to popular fitness myths. They mention low intensity training for fat loss, create the illusion that all
resistance training programs are for bodybuilders (or that everyone should weight train like a bodybuilder), and
some even go as far as assuming everyone has to run to get fit. Fit for what?
